Folios 302-304: Edward Brace, HMS Camilla, Spithead. As the purser of the ship is currently in Winchester Gaol, and the officer appointed in his stead has not joined, Brace has been obliged to buy coals and candles, about which he has written to the Victualling Board. As he has had no response, asks if their Lordships will intervene on his behalf so that he may recoup his expenses. Reverse of sheet shows his two letters, dated 1 and 12 January, the first stating the shortage of fuel and asking for instruction, the second saying that in default of a reply he has had to purchase fuel and candles to the sum of £5.18s. and hopes they will honour his draft.
